Sustainable Textile Wastewater Treatment with Cationic Polyacrylamide

The textile industry, while vital, faces significant challenges in wastewater management due to the complex nature of its effluents. NINGBO INNO PHARMCHEM CO.,LTD. offers a powerful solution through Cationic Polyacrylamide (CPAM), a highly effective flocculant that plays a critical role in sustainable textile wastewater treatment. CPAM works by neutralizing the negatively charged suspended particles and dyes in the wastewater, causing them to aggregate into larger, more easily separable flocs. This process dramatically improves the clarity of the treated water and significantly reduces the pollution load.


One of the key benefits of CPAM in textile wastewater management is its ability to facilitate efficient sludge dewatering. By forming denser, more compact flocs, CPAM enables faster settling and more effective filtration or centrifugation, resulting in drier sludge cakes. This not only reduces the volume of sludge requiring disposal but also lowers associated handling and transportation costs. When considering the overall environmental impact, the use of textile sizing chemicals with low COD (Chemical Oxygen Demand) is paramount. Cationic Polyacrylamide contributes to this by helping to remove organic pollutants that contribute to high COD levels in textile effluents, thereby assisting mills in meeting stringent environmental regulations.
